Popular Christmas Traditions and Christmas Decorations in Germany

Popular Christmas Traditions and Christmas Decorations in Germany


Christmas is a month of delight in Germany beginning with the start of Advent four Sundays prior to Christmas Eve. German's prepare for Christmas by baking, making gifts and decorating. Some evenings are especially set aside for the baking of treats like Lebkuchen with Egg White Icing, Stollen and spiced cakes. Glhwein (mulled red wine, lemons, cloves and cinnamon) or Feuerzangenbowle (mulled wine with ginger, oranges, brown rum and a sugar cone set aflame until the sugar melts) are often served on bake nights as well as enjoyed on cold evenings.

Children start off the holidays by opening up the first flap of their Advent calendar which counts down the four weeks leading up to Christmas. Each flap opens to reveal a piece of chocolate shaped into special Christmas symbols such as an angel or a bell. Some families set up an Advent Wreath with candles in the center on the same day. On each Sunday before Christmas, families light one candle and gather around the wreath to sing Christmas carols. Children put out their shoes on December 5th, Nikolaustag, in the hopes of finding presents the next morning. Good children receive small gifts, fruits, nuts and chocolates while naughty children receive a rod.

Some evenings are spent in the city center where big markets are set up, decorated and filled with vendors selling arts and crafts. People can enjoy a good meal of Backfisch (fried fish on fresh bread), grilled sausage and a mug of Glhwein as they wander. Stalls have toys, gifts and marzipan confections shaped like fruits, Christmas symbols and animals. Some markets also have nativity scenes to look at as well as performing musicians and dancers.


The tradition of the decorated Christmas tree is believed to have originated in Germany and Christmas wreaths first became popular in Germany. Christmas trees are decorated with strings of lights or real candles, homemade cookies, apples, nuts, special ornaments that have been handed down over the generations, tinsel and chocolates. Some families choose to have more than one Christmas tree while other families lock the tree and presents in a room. This room is opened at midnight on Christmas Eve to the delight of the children who see the tree glittering and sparkling, as well as presents underneath, for the first time.

The white Advent Candle is lit on Christmas Day. Families spend the day together, attend church and enjoy Christmas dinner. A traditional German Christmas dinner usually has Roast Goose, a dish which originated from Britain in the early 1600's. Carp is another popular Christmas dish as is Potato salad with Weiner. Side dishes include red cabbage, roast potatoes and kale. Dessert is an anticipated event with German specialties such as Christstollen, Marzipantorte and Rumkugeln to indulge in.
